LT-SOOT RELEASE - Low Temperature Soot Remover
Description
LT SOOT RELEASE low temperature soot remover is a unique, catalytic powder designed to effectively reduce combustion deposits and to maintain clean heat transfer surfaces in exhaust boilers. Soot deposits in the exhaust system waste energy, cause corrosion, increase stack fire potential and can lead to costly repairs. The low activation temperature 200° C (392° F) of LT SOOT RELEASE soot remover makes it ideal for today's efficient energy recovery systems in motorships. LT SOOT RELEASE soot remover works by reducing the ignition temperature of the organic deposits of incomplete combustion, which bind the adherent ash deposits. In doing so, deposits become friable losing their adherent properties, and are easily removed and eliminated during normal sootblowingoperations.

Application and Use
Although designed specifically for use in diesel exhaust gas economizers, LT SOOT RELEASE low temperature soot remover can be used in any fireside application such as: • Firetube boilers • Donkey boilers • Water-tube boilers/H.P. and L.P. • Auxiliary boilers • Main boilers The recommended dosage rate is 1 kg/day for every 400-500 m2 of surface area to be treated. However, variations in engine load, boiler design, heating surface configurations and the amount of deposits may alter this dosage rate. For vessels with exhaust gas temperatures below 250° C (482° F), it is recommended that the dosage rate be increased 1.5 kg/ day for every 400-500 m2 of surface area. LT SOOT RELEASE soot remover is usually slug dosed to the exhaust trunk using the LT SOOT RELEASE dosing unit.
A. Exhaust Gas Economizer System
1. General
a. For this system, LT SOOT RELEASE soot remover is injected just prior to the exhaust gas economizer inlet beyond the bypass damper (if one is fitted). However, dosing can take place anywhere in the system depending on where fouling is a problem. b. In instances where the air stream is too fast to develop sufficient contact time, it may be necessary to partially bypass the economizer or slow the engine to half speed or less during dosing in order to achieve maximum product performance.

Typical Physical Properties
Appearance: Light green, free-flowing granular powder
Density: 1.28 gm/cm3 (80 lb./ft.3)
Flash Point: None
Activation Temperature: 200° C (392° F)
